I hear a lot of people saying they don't think they can change, but you can. We all can. It's called neuroplasticity. Not only can you change your mind, you can change your brain. Do a web search forneuroplasticity and addiction and read about it.

On a similar note, I'm reading a very interesting book at the moment about the psychology of changing the dynamics of a romantic relationship or marriage called Getting The Love You Want by Harville Hendrix. He believes that people can change their behaviour by getting their conscious decision-making brain to co-ordinate better with our instinctive sub-conscious brain. The theory seems plausible. There are some exercises to try as well which are illuminating.

Thanks Zero. This makes so much sense! I like the analogy of the link between drinking and the pleasure center of our brain is a well worn road. We can create new roads to the pleasure center, but the old road will not go away. We just can't travel it again or we can get caught in one of its ruts.
